bound4blue has secured a Design Assessment from Bureau Veritas for its Model 3-24 eSAIL wind propulsion system. The assessment confirms that the suction sail design has been independently reviewed against Bureau Veritas’ technical requirements. The recognition comes as bound4blue expands the deployment of its wind propulsion technology across commercial shipping. More than 50 eSAIL units ordered bound4blue said more than 50 eSAIL units have now been ordered . Its technology has already been installed on 13 vessels , while another six vessels are in the company’s orderbook. The Model 3 range includes sails from 24 to 36 metres high. The Model 3-24 completed its first commercial installation earlier this year. The system was installed aboard Klaveness Combination Carriers’ newbuild MV Baltazar . The larger Model 3 range is designed to extend the technology to bigger vessels. Bureau Veritas reviews Model 3-24 design The Design Assessment was presented during SMM 2026 in Hamburg. Bureau Veritas reviewed the Model 3-24 against its technical requirements. “Wind propulsion is becoming an increasingly important element of the maritime industry’s decarbonisation journey,” said David Barrow, SVP for Western Europe and Americas at Bureau Veritas Marine & Offshore. He added that independent technical assessments can provide greater confidence as wind propulsion systems mature. Suction sails target lower fuel consumption The eSAIL system uses boundary layer suction to generate propulsive force from wind. According to bound4blue, the technology can generate up to seven times more propulsive force than a rigid sail of the same size . The system works alongside a vessel’s conventional propulsion system. It can be installed on both existing vessels and newbuilds. bound4blue said its eSAIL technology can deliver double-digit fuel savings , depending on the vessel and operating conditions.
